NEW YORK, NY and CHICAGO, IL / ACCESSWIRE / September 10, 2024 / Wolf Haldenstein Adler Freeman & Herz LLP, a preeminent national consumer rights law firm, investigating claims on behalf of customers of Kemper Sports Management ("Kemper Sports") of Northbrook, Illinois,whose information may be have stolen as part of a recent data breach. Kemper Sports is notifying customers that their personal information, including at least names and Social Security numbers, may have been stolen.
